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Removal

Don’t ignore these warning signs, or you might end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Water damage can spread quickly, causing thousands of dollars in damage to your property. Act fast and catch these signs early to pr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your bathroom that won’t go away, it’s a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, or you might end up with mold and mildew growth. Get it checked out today to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ls are a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ore them, or you might end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Get it fixed today to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per is a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, or you might end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Get it checked out today to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, or you might end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Get it fixed today to prevent further damage.

Discolored or Fuzzy Grout

Discolored or fuzzy grout is a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, or you might end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Get it checked out today to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Leaks

Visible water leaks are a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ore them, or you might end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Get it fixed today to prevent further damage.

Bathro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No Easy to fix with basic tools and knowledge.
Large water leak on the floor No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Water damage to the ceiling or walls No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ove mold and prevent further growth.
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air or replace damaged flooring.
Discolored or fuzzy grout No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air or replace damaged grout.

Bathroom Water Removal Cost In Surprise, AZ

The cost of Bathroom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Surprise, AZ. These are estimates, not guarantees, and the actual cost may be higher or lower.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and determining the best course of action.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Emergency Response $500 – $2,000 Time of day, day of the week, and availability of technicians.
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.

Common Questions About Bathroom Water Removal

Q: What causes water damage in bathrooms?

A: Water damage in bathrooms is often caused by leaks under sinks, around toilets, and behind showers. It can also be caused by clogged drains, faulty plumbing, and overflowing toilets. We’ll help you identify the source of the damage and provide a solution to prevent it from happening again.

Q: How long does it take to remove water from a bathroom?

A: The time it takes to remove water from a bathroom dep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In some cases, it can take just a few hours, while in other cases, it may take several days. We’ll work with you to ensure the job is done as quickly and efficiently as possible.

Q: Is water damage covered by insurance?

A: Yes, water damage is often covered by insurance, but it depends on the type of policy you have and the circumstances surrounding the damage.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ure you get the coverage you deserve.

Q: Can I prevent water damage in my bathroom?

A: Yes, there are several ways to prevent water damage in your bathroom. Reg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ks and ensuring proper drainage, can go a long way in preventing damage. We’ll provide you with tips on how to prevent water damage in your bathroom.
